Enterprise Sales Support jobs represent a critical and dynamic career path at the intersection of sales, customer service, and internal operations. Professionals in these roles are the vital backbone of a high-performing sales organization, specifically within the complex world of enterprise-level business. Their primary mission is to empower the sales team to focus on closing high-value deals by managing the intricate logistical, administrative, and customer-facing processes that underpin a successful sales cycle. This is not a passive role; it is an active, strategic function that directly influences revenue generation and customer satisfaction. Individuals in Enterprise Sales Support jobs typically handle a wide array of responsibilities that ensure the sales engine runs smoothly. Common duties include managing the customer relationship management (CRM) database to ensure data accuracy and pipeline visibility. They are often responsible for creating and processing complex quotes, proposals, and contracts, navigating billing systems, and handling software licensing intricacies for large clients. A significant part of the role involves providing direct support to both the internal sales representatives and the enterprise customers themselves. This can range from answering pre-sales questions about product configurations to managing post-sales onboarding support, ensuring a seamless customer journey from initial interest to successful adoption. Furthermore, these specialists frequently analyze customer segments and sales data to provide the sales team with actionable insights, identify upsell opportunities, and help discover new business prospects. They act as a crucial liaison, collaborating with other departments such as finance, legal, and product development to resolve customer issues and improve internal processes. The typical skill set required for success in Enterprise Sales Support jobs is a unique blend of technical, analytical, and interpersonal abilities. Strong written and verbal communication skills are paramount, as the role requires clear and effective interaction with sophisticated clients and internal stakeholders. A keen attention to detail is non-negotiable, given the responsibility for handling critical commercial documents and data. Problem-solving skills and a solution-oriented mindset are essential for navigating the complex challenges that arise in enterprise deals. Familiarity with key business software, particularly CRM platforms like Salesforce and various ERP systems, is a common requirement. While formal education often includes a background in business, marketing, or a related field, a genuine curiosity for technology and a proven interest in the sales process are just as important. These jobs are ideal for organized, proactive individuals who thrive in a fast-paced environment, can manage multiple tasks under pressure, and are driven by enabling the success of their team and the satisfaction of their customers. For those seeking a collaborative and impactful career that sits at the heart of business operations, Enterprise Sales Support offers a rewarding and promising professional path.
